Project Title: Turbidity Modeling in the Adriatic Sea 

Principal Investigator(s): Richard Signell, Farid Askari 

Funding Agency(s): NATO/SACLANT Undersea Research Centre 

Description of the Research Project and Justification for Real-time SeaWiFS Data:

This project seeks to assess the performance of coupled light/sediment/optics models
using the Adriatic Sea as a natural laboratory in the context of a major collaborative
experiment.  We are comparing various meteo, ocean, sediment, and optics models:
COAMPS, LAMI, NCOM, ROMS and LSOM and collecting insitu data from moored and shipboard
optical instruments.

The near realtime SeaWiFS data will be used for adaptive sampling of optical properties
while at sea in the Adriatic, and for comparison to simulated model results.
